Climate Change and the Global Push for Renewable Energy

Climate change is one of the most pressing challenges of our time, and the global push for renewable energy is central to reducing greenhouse gas emissions.

Solar and Wind Power
Solar and wind power have become the leading sources of renewable energy, with countries around the world investing in large-scale installations. These technologies provide a cleaner alternative to fossil fuels and are becoming increasingly cost-effective due to advancements in technology.

Electric Vehicles
The rise of electric vehicles (EVs) is another significant step toward a greener future. As more automakers shift to producing EVs and governments implement incentives for buyers, the transportation sector is moving away from gasoline-powered cars, reducing emissions.

Challenges to the Transition
Despite the progress, transitioning to renewable energy faces challenges, including the need for better energy storage solutions and the cost of updating infrastructure. Governments, businesses, and individuals must continue to work together to overcome these obstacles.
